Mr Newby first opened Flamingo on Talbot Road in 1979 - Blackpool's first gay nightclub.
-
The venue was demolished in 2007 and its former dancefloor now sits beneath aisle 22 of the Sainsbury's supermarket that opened in 2014.
Funny Girls, now based in the former Odeon Cinema on Dickson Road, is still going strong and celebrated its 30th anniversary last year.
The showbar originally launched in a converted corner shop on Queen Street where it was an instant success.
In 2002, the venue moved into the historic Grade II-listed Odeon building, with none other than Joan Collins officiating its grand reopening.
Over the years, the venue has attracted a host of celebrities, including RuPaul, and the Pet Shop Boys.
It has also made appearances on major shows like BBC's Strictly Come Dancing and the Royal Variety Performance.
Reflecting on that transition, Basil said: “We outgrew the building on Queen Street. Funny Girls took off so phenomenally that I bought the premises next door.
"Then, out of the blue, the council issued a Compulsory Purchase Order on Flamingo and also bought the old Odeon which was empty at the time.
"At the same time, Walkabout approached me to buy the Funny Girls building.”
